Las Terrenas is reached by two main roads: one from Sanchez at the western end of the peninsula and the other from the city of Samana by way of the village of El Limon and the resort at El Portillo. Both roads follow a winding route over the mountains and through the lush valleys across the peninsula and provide a scenic and sometimes spectacular view of the rich, mountainous terrain with its simple, country life.

Vehicle rental agencies may be found in Las Terrenas and Samana. Most of these offer delivery service to your hotel.
Adventure Rent Car is available at most airports in DR, and run by a very helpful lady, Gipsy Harold Ureña, Tel:809-307-7202
It should be noted that for both local and national rentals, the vehicle must be returned to the location from where it was rented..

Motorcycles, Scooters and ATV's
For the back roads of the peninsula and especially day trips to Playa del Valle and Playa Rincon, an ATV or motorcycle is recommended. On possibility is "Auceen Raid Aventure and Fun Rental" in Las Terrenas

One of the places that we passed on our excursion was the airport. If you don't come in by air or by sea, it is a long three hour drive over bad roads to get to the rest of the D.R. This little airstrip at El Portillo is just a few miles east of Las Terrenas. Aerodomca has scheduled flights daily for the 30 minutes flight from Santo Domingo and air-charter service may be booked for flights from the major airports in the Dominican Republic(Puerto Plata, Santiago or Punta Cana).

Getting to El Portillo is possible by bus but only to a certain distance. Caribe Tours and Metro will take you to Samaná and from there you must take another bus. Metro will also take you to Sánchez which is closer to the hotel. We ordered pick up at Sánchez for an additional fee and asked the driver to stop to take pictures (like the one in the overview page). On the way back to Sánchez we 3 and 4 other people shared a hotel minibus to the Metro bus pickup and split the bill.
